Asynchronous balance positive-torque oil pumping machine
Technical field
The utility model relates to the oil extraction in oil field field, the asynchronous balance positive-torque oil pumping machine of especially a kind of employing three counterweights, four-throw.
Background technology
At present, the oil extraction in oil field mode comprises plunger displacement pump, screw pump, electric submersible pump, hydraulic pump, gaslift etc. both at home and abroad.Wherein, sucker-rod pumping technique still occupy space of top prominence in all kinds of artificial lift oil production methods.,Chu Middle East, oil field, whole world majority is outside flowing well, most sucker rod pumping technology that adopt, the oil well of the whole world more than 75% used the sucker rod pumping mode, the nearly 400,000 mouthfuls of wells of China, except screw pump, electric immersible pump well account for 25%, rod-pumped well has 250,000 mouthfuls more than.But to be fluctuating load large and exist the negative torque negative power to cause the problems such as system effectiveness is low, energy consumption is large for current pumping well system, the subject matter of existence.
Summary of the invention
In order to overcome the deficiency that existing beam pumping unit fluctuating load is large, system effectiveness is low, the utility model provides a kind of asynchronous balance positive-torque oil pumping machine, and this asynchronous balance positive-torque oil pumping machine has the advantages that load impacting is little, system effectiveness is high, power consumption is few.
The technical solution of the utility model is: a kind of asynchronous balance positive-torque oil pumping machine, comprise driven crank shaft, on driven crank shaft, be connected with driven moveable pulley for single-crank, also comprise the driving crank rotating shaft, the driving crank rotating shaft connects the driving crank balancing weight by driving crank, and driving crank is two sections, by rotating shaft, connects between two sections, be connected with connecting rod between its rotating shaft and driven moveable pulley for single-crank rotating shaft.
On described driven moveable pulley for single-crank, be wound with wire rope, an end of wire rope is by well head fixed pulley connecting with pumping rod, other end connecting steel wire ropes locking bed.
The utlity model has following beneficial effect: owing to taking such scheme, outside driven crank shaft, increase the driving crank rotating shaft, driving crank, driving crank and the uniform rotation of driving crank balancing weight, driven crank speed change is rotated, upstroke speed is reduced, peak load reduces, down stroke speed is increased, minimum load increases, namely utilize barycenter trajectory and the past multiple equilibria of well head balance weight of driving crank balancing weight and driven crank balancing weight, mating with load phase together of comprehensive each counterweight center of gravity, reduce fluctuating load, thereby realize omnidistance positive-torque, improved the operating efficiency of oil pumper.And this Pumping Unit is compact, take up an area less, simplify on basis, and rotating moving part all is enclosed between fixture, realizes the running safety of field unattended.

The specific embodiment
The utility model is described in further detail below in conjunction with accompanying drawing:
By Fig. 1, shown in 2, a kind of asynchronous balance positive-torque oil pumping machine, comprise well head 10, sucker rod 9, driven crank shaft 4, driven crank shaft 4 connects driven crank balancing weight 12 by driven crank, driven crank is two sections, between two sections, connect by rotating shaft, in rotating shaft, also be connected with driven moveable pulley for single-crank 3, on described driven moveable pulley for single-crank 3, be wound with wire rope 6, the left end of wire rope 6 is connected with the device 7 of restricting, connect the left end of the device 7 of restricting by well head fixed pulley 8 connecting with pumping rods 9, the right-hand member connecting steel wire ropes locking bed 5 of wire rope 6, a side relative with sucker rod 9 on well head fixed pulley 8 is connected with well head balance weight 13.This oil pumper also comprises driving crank rotating shaft 1, driving crank rotating shaft 1 connects driving crank balancing weight 11 by driving crank 14, and driving crank 14 is two sections, by rotating shaft, connects between two sections, be connected with connecting rod 2 between the rotating shaft of its rotating shaft and driven moveable pulley for single-crank 3.
According to force analysis, the pin joint place of driving crank 14 is subject to power F
3Upwards component, driving crank counterweight block 11 be subject to in lower gravity F
2, the power that driving crank rotating shaft 1 is moved is F
3, F
2Make a concerted effort, because two power are opposite at vertical direction, so it is less to make a concerted effort, reasonable stress.In like manner, driven moveable pulley for single-crank 3 is subjected to force direction opposite with driven crank balancing weight 12 gravity direction in the vertical directions, the suffered minimum of making a concerted effort of driven crank shaft 4.Like this, driving crank rotating shaft 1, driven crank shaft 4 load are little, save material, life-extending.Well head balance weight 13 can utilize sandstone to regulate, and cost is low, easy to adjust.
During oil pumper work, speed reducer output shaft drives driving crank 14 and rotates around driving crank rotating shaft 1, by connecting rod 2, driving driven crank rotates around driving crank rotating shaft 4, driven moveable pulley for single-crank on driven crank pulls wire rope 6, because wire rope locking seat 5 is fixedly dead points of wire rope, wire rope pulls sucker rod 9 to move up and down by fixed pulley 8, realizes reciprocal reciprocating oil pumping; Simultaneously, by well head fixed pulley 8, increase well head and join piece 13, regulate according to each well concrete condition the weight that well head is joined piece 13, fractional load while carrying out the balance upstroke, reduce load impacting, thereby realize the omnidistance positive-torque work of oil pumper.Simultaneously, this pumping unit system is simple and compact for structure, simply take up an area less on basis, easy for installation, and rotating motion part is enclosed between fixture, thereby realizes the running safety of field unattended.
